Today

Surf rebuilds ahead of a weekend peak of new SSW swell. Not as big as the 8th-10th but still solid.

The downturn in surf for the tail end of the weekhas size in the chest shoulder high range for the day as standouts are head-high to overhead+.

The dip won't last for long as a new swell (205-195) arrives thanks to a moderate strength, but large and favorably tracking storm recently in the central SPAC.

While not a crazy one, this thing will still have some pop with good spots comfortably overhead, while top spots are several feet overhead.

Nine Palms Surf Guide

This Baja Sur pointbreak has been a high-ranking hotspot on surfers' Cabo itineraries for decades - and it's definitely one of the most popular waves on the East Cape, despite the fact that it's not world-class by any means. Under head-high, Nine Palms is a bit mushy and slow. However, when an overhead summer S swell drains in, Nine Palms ignites into a reeling wall with plenty of perfectly crackable sections.
